Programme of ' the Ceremonial to bk observed ON THE BIRTH OF A CHILD TO Mr. dluqs, one of the -soa'kueigns of America. , - AVc publish the following account of the proceedings of the birth of an American Sov ereign. It is one of the best things of the season, and the Philadelphia Bulletin is responsible for it: - .. - r ' ' . When Mrs. Diggs begins to fuel that the long-expecte I time has at lust arrived, she will wake Digg from the sound sleep he will be enjoying, ami on his asking, 'what is the mat ter r he will bo informed by Mrs. Diggs. , As soon as Diggs c in hastily get on his pantaloons, boots and coat, he shall take the orders of Mrs. Diggs and go immediately for the Xurse, the Grand Mistress of Diggs' household, and after escorting the Gaand Mistress to his door, he shall inform the family physician, Avho shall immediately repair to the Diggs Castle, Diggs shall also convey the information of Avhat is transpiring to all who hold rank in his household, r His mother-in-law she shall appear in whatever clothes she can find handy, tho state of her nerves, on learning the facts, leing in such a condition as to prevent an elaborate toilet. On arriving at the Diggs Castle, she shall exclaim, "Ah nay poor, dear Emily,' and a look at Diggs, as if she thought him the Avorst of criminals. Diggs, on receiving this look in silence, shall cause the head cook and the Maid of tho Bedchambers to be called, and be in waiting in an ante room for whaieA-er orders the Grand Mis tress of the Household may rend them. Diggs is expected to faithfully execute all these orders in not less than ten minutes, and when they are accomplished, Diggs is at liberty to retire to his private apartments, and there await further orders from the Grand Mistress of the Household. In the meanwhile his nervous system may require a little weak toddy, and in the intervals of propping his nerves, Diggs shall frequently declare that he wishes the tiling was all oa er. ' ; : In the chamber of Mrs. Diggs there shall onlv be the nhvsician, the Grand Mistress of the Household and the mother-in-laAv. The latter distinguished personage, before many days, will make an clfort to r out rank the Grand Mistress of the Household, and in the tilts which ensue consequent upon this effort, Diggs is expected to take both sides and carry water on both shoulders. ..The cook shall retire to the kitchen, stir up her fire, and hold herself ready, for any service needed. The Maid of the Bed Chambers shall assemble herself any who within calling distance from the door of Mrs. Diggs' apartment, and when the Grand Mistress of the 1 household gives her ordeis and tells her net to be all day about it, she shall obey them. . At the moment at Avhicn the last pains shall be felt. Dices shall be informed that it is nearly all over. Diggs will put more questions! than can be answered, and ne Avill De tola to wait a little Avhile lonjer, that his dear Emily is' bearing up wonderfully, and - frequently calls upon her dear, Tommy., Thomas Diggs shall sigli, and wish it avus all over a;a:n. ? In the morning, wtien tne room-is pui 10 rights, Diggs shall be called to Mrs. Diggsapartments, and the child shall be presented to him by the Giand Mistress' of the Household, and Diggs shall examine it first with profound astonishment, and then assuming a more iovial air shall touch its little cheek and call it,-"the dear weeny, beeny; little thing!" Dieirs shall then kiss his dear ümiiy aoout one dozen times and express much sympathy for . ar . "11 x I l: her sullerings., iurs. uiggs avui tuen give mm distinctly to understand that that child is tho last, and that men nave no laeaoi me suujr-inn-s of noor women. The child's name haviog been long fixed, Diggs shall then proceed to the parlor, and taking dOAvn the lamuy bible shall make a minute (jproces verbal) of the birth of the child, in accordance with the long established usages of the American sovereigns. Soon after daylight, the aunts and cousins , and all the relation that are recognized by the famiiv. includinc: all tho relations of the moth er-in-law. shall call at the house, and be informed of all the particulars by the motner-in-law. The cook and Maid of the Bed-cnamoers will convey the intelligence over tho backyard fence .to the cook and maid of the bedl,nl,.c novr rinnr nurl theV will COnveY it to the cook and maids of the bed chambers of the second vard, so that every lamiiy m w block shall 'receive intelligence of the joytul event by breakfast time. 7 " Dip-o-s will then take his breakfast without Jki;no. nhont the cookery, and proceed to il uiuui.... - - his place of business, isy tnis manner uiggs will indicate to nis icuuw ouuMijua tv.0 ohilri is a boy or a girl. If it is a boy. rwo-s will be unusually lively he will walk .iTh & sDrins his face will be covered with smiles he will' in fact, make every one he meets exclaim, ' there goes a happy dog."

it is a girl, he will feel happy and look happy,, but his happiness will be subdued, quiot and. calm. ...,When he arrives at his place of, buair ness, he will there proclaim the great event," and is not expected to notice any littlo jokM which may be perpetrated at his expensa., Diggs will return home at least siz time, during the first day.
